3rd floor at the end of the North Hall.
The glass in the picture frame had been broken out at the top and in the middle but there was broken glass shards at the bottom of the picture frame. On 2/20/2026 at 11:21am V9 (Housekeeper) stated the picture frame is broken with glass shards and if someone bumps into the picture frame it could be dangerous.On 2/20/2026 at 11:22am V26 (Certified Nursing Assistant) stated it's a broken picture frame with glass shards protruding from the bottom of the frame and it is a hazard to residents and can be used as a weapon.On 2/20/2026 at 11:28am surveyor observed, on the second floor, the wall, in the shower room, behind the toilet with a brown substance splattered on the wall and a yellowish gray and black debris on the bottom of the toilet and floor.On 2/20/2026 at 11:30am V16 (Housekeeper) stated the brown substance looks like feces on the wall and the yellowish gray substances looks like urine and the bathroom should be cleaned twice a day and this mess should have been cleaned up.On 2/20/2026 at 2:08pm V25 (Maintenance Director) stated he was made aware that there was a picture frame on 3 North about 5 minutes after the surveyor saw it and that the frame had been taken down. V25 stated that it was not documented in the work order binder.On 2/21/2026 at 8:48am V28 (Housekeeping Director) stated yes, the entire toilet and the wall behind it should be cleaned daily and as needed and the purpose is to disinfect the bathroom and allow it to appear homelike. No, I was not aware that there was a broken picture frame with glass shards still in the frame on 3 North. V28 stated he will make sure those two items (bathroom cleaned and picture frame removed) are taken care of.
